oh yeah also 4" plastic pots with saucers next time you always want drainage so roots establish well. Use those foam cups for cloning they retain water cutings establish well in them, excess water can be good when you want a branch to form roots.
I will keep the t12 closer next time when they are starting out. You think I should keep them on the t12 until I the 4th/5th set of true leaves is up, or when should I switch them to the MH? Also, had them sitting in cups with holes in the bottom and then another cup around that one. When I transplanted them today to the next size pot, they had roots all the way down and reaching into the outer cup that was still retaining a little bit of water.
